    Microsoft sunsets WINS (Windows Internet Naming Service) by 2034, urging migration to DNS. WINS, NetBIOS, legacy systems pose security risks, requiring careful auditing and modernization. Migration is a test for legacy technology management.

    WINS fixed a crucial challenge: how to attach the names utilized to recognize computers using the 1980s’ NetBIOS network naming system with modern-day IP addresses. DNS, an ordered system that worked for Internet along with network addresses, had actually provided NetBIOS out-of-date. But both ended up co-existing, examples of how the market supplied more than one response to the same issue.

    Security Risks and Spoofing Attacks

    Success had major design constraints that made it a protection risk, stated Wright. “WINS has no device to validate the legitimacy of name registrations, that makes it prone to spoofing assaults,” stated Wright.

    Currently, Microsoft has actually stated, the last operating system to support victories will be Windows Web server 2025. That’s what figures out the nine-year last migration deadline– the life expectancy of Windows Web server 2025 on the Long-Term Servicing Channel (LTSC).

    Worse, the existence of victory usually suggested that a target was using other vulnerable tradition methods. “Systems usually fall back to NetBIOS program queries when WINS isn’t offered, which are spoofable on local networks. This is exactly what tools like -responder exploit, and it stays an usual method in infiltration testing and real-world assaults alike.”

    Microsoft has provided system managers until 2034 to stop using success (Windows Internet Call Service) NetBIOS name resolution innovation in their networks– yet also nine years may not suffice notice for some: WINS is quite still being used, sustaining a niche series of difficult-to-replace legacy systems.

    Simply put, Microsoft had no strategies to patch the concern. Its service was that clients move far from victories, a procedure it has considering that come to be clear could still be recurring for some consumers right into the 2030s.

    Equally, according to William Wright of pen-testing firm Closed Door Security, WINS was still running on some networks for the exact same factor that lots of heritage technologies overstay their usefulness: movement passiveness.

    “Many companies running victory today possibly aren’t actively utilizing it for anything vital. They have actually simply never had an engaging reason to transform it off,” he stated. “It’s been quietly duplicating in the background, consuming marginal sources, creating no noticeable troubles. That’s the nature of tradition infrastructure: It persists not due to the fact that it’s needed, however because removing it calls for initiative and brings risk, while leaving it alone is complimentary,” said Wright.

    WINS days from Windows NT in 1994 and has actually time out of mind been displaced by the a lot more modern-day Domain Name System (DNS). It was deprecated in 2021 to accompany the appearance of Windows Web server 2022. This meant it would certainly be sustained yet no more established, a clear signal that the clock was ticking.

    “Legacy technologies persist because some particular niche systems like industrial/OT environments are engineered for multi‑decade lifecycles. Many control systems are architecturally dealt with and can’t be re‑platformed,” he stated. “It’s additionally hard for Microsoft: WINS sits deep in the networking stack which implies getting rid of a once‑core part needs exhaustive regression to stay clear of unexpected damage.”

    “The trade-off is that customers still using WINS have to place in the work to relocate to DNS by auditing dependences, isolating or modernizing tradition work, and executing DNS. But the payback is an easier, extra safe platform.

    “For OT heaps developed around WINS/NetBIOS, replacing them isn’t trivial since transforming name resolution touches safety‑critical systems and bespoke integrations,” stated Kieran Bhardwaj, head of protection engineering at UK cyber safety working as a consultant Bridewell, which focuses on advising on crucial facilities.

    “Organizations making use of success are strongly urged to move to contemporary DNS-based name resolution services,” the company claimed, maybe specifying the obvious, in a Windows Message Center advisory in very early November.

    WINS movement is yet another tradition concern acquired from the innovative ferment of computer system networking in the 1980s and 1990s. That era required solutions to great deals of networking problems in a hurry, specifically how to transform a desktop PC operating system such as DOS or Windows right into a practical web server system.

    Searching for WINS still switched on inside a network was a godsend to hackers utilizing open-source tools such as -responder to perform name resolution poisoning strikes versus legacy Windows procedures such as Link-Local Multicast Name Resolution (LLMNR) and the NetBIOS Name Solution (NBT-NS), Wright included.
